The pattern of a fairy tale generally leads to a happy ending. No matter the situation of the overall tale, the main character is bound to find what they were usually consciously/subconsciously trying to find: love. It is an insidious 'pattern' that has been ingested by Americans, and in turn, 'contemporary women' may be unsure on how to maintain the difference between real life and the fairy tale fantasy.
